Generic Agencies Don’t Understand Dual-Season, Dual-Intent HVAC
A homeowner searching “AC blowing hot air” at 3pm in July has 45 minutes of patience. A homeowner searching “furnace replacement cost” in October is comparing three quotes over a week. Commercial property managers searching “RTU replacement contractor” have a 60-day buying cycle. Generic SEO agencies use the same blog-and-backlink template for all three. HVAC-specialist SEO maps service pages, GBP signals, schema, and conversion paths to the exact job type, season, and buying stage — because the margins depend on it.

The SEO Doctors Methodology
A proven, repeatable process built from real industry-specific engagements — not generic agency templates.
Google Business Profile Optimisation for HVAC
We rebuild your GBP as an HVAC-specific local landing page — categories, service attributes, equipment-brand specialisations, 24/7 emergency signalling, photo velocity, Q&A seeding, and review reply cadence that matches Google’s 2025 local ranking signals.
Service-Page Architecture Built Around High-Margin Jobs
Instead of one generic “services” page, we build dedicated pages for each high-ticket service (heat pump install, full AC replacement, ductless retrofit, commercial RTU), each with financing options, tax credit info, AHRI-rated equipment examples, and city-level modifiers.
HVAC-Relevant Link Building and PR
We earn links from HVAC industry publications (ACHR News, Contracting Business, The NEWS), local news coverage (energy-saving tips, storm response), home-improvement authority sites, and supplier/manufacturer contractor directories. Quality over volume — one link from ACHR News beats fifty from link farms.
Programmatic City × Service × System Page Deployment
We generate location + service pages at scale — one page per city × service combination — each with genuinely local data (climate zone, local utility rebate, nearby landmark references, local competitor audit) to stay on the right side of Google’s doorway-page policy.

HVAC-Specific Link Building Strategy
Backlinks remain one of Google’s top three ranking factors. For HVAC contractors, quality and relevance matters more than volume — a link from a top HVAC authority site is worth more than 50 random directory links.
Industry Citations & Directories
We build your presence across the top 60 HVAC and HVAC-specific directories: Angi, HomeAdvisor, Thumbtack, Yelp, BBB, Modernize, Networx, Houzz, and local industry society listings. Consistent NAP signals across these platforms is a foundational local SEO requirement.
Professional Association Links
ACCA (Air Conditioning Contractors of America), SMACNA, ASHRAE, RSES, NATE, Nexstar Network member directories, state association listings, and speciality organisation memberships provide high-authority, relevant backlinks. We identify and obtain every legitimate professional link your credentials qualify for.
Local Community & PR Links
Sponsoring local events, charitable initiatives, and neighbourhood organisations generates genuine local links that signal geographic relevance to Google. We identify opportunities in your area and support the outreach process to turn community involvement into SEO value.
Content Partnerships
Guest articles on local news sites, industry publications, and lifestyle blogs. Topics aligned to your services position you as an expert source and generate editorial backlinks. Zero paid links — everything earned through content value.
